Neighborhood Overview

Vollrath Park is strategically situated along the scenic shores of Lake Michigan in Sheboygan, Wisconsin. Its prime location offers beautiful waterfront views and easy access to the city's amenities. The park is bordered by North 10th Street to the west and the expansive Lake Michigan to the east, with Michigan Avenue serving as a main artery to the south and Park Avenue to the north. Access to the park is straightforward via major roadways like I-43, with exits leading directly to city streets that guide you to the park's entrances. The nearest major airport is Milwaukee Mitchell International Airport (MKE), approximately a 60-mile drive south, requiring about a 1-hour to 1-hour-and-30-minute commute depending on traffic. Local transit options are limited within the immediate park vicinity, making personal vehicles or rideshares the most common modes of transport. For those arriving by car, diligent attention to parking signs on event days is crucial, as popular weekends can see significant local traffic converging on the park’s entrances. Planning to arrive at least 30 minutes prior to scheduled activities is a sound strategy to avoid last-minute congestion.

Things to Do

Walkable

Vollrath Park Carousel

On site

The historic Vollrath Park Carousel is a beloved attraction for all ages, offering delightful rides that evoke a sense of nostalgia. Operating seasonally, this charming carousel is a highlight for families visiting the park. Its presence adds a classic amusement park feel to the recreational grounds. Adjacent to the carousel, you'll find playgrounds and picnic areas, making it a central hub for family fun and gatherings. Check the operational schedule, as hours can vary based on the season and specific community events.

Lakefront Walking Paths

On site

Vollrath Park boasts an extensive network of paved walking paths that meander along the beautiful Lake Michigan shoreline. These paths are perfect for a leisurely stroll, a brisk jog, or a scenic bike ride, offering stunning views of the water and the natural surroundings. The main path connects to the larger Sheboygan shore trail system, allowing for extended exploration. Benches are strategically placed along the route, providing ideal spots to rest, enjoy the lake breeze, and take in the picturesque landscape.

5–15 Minutes Away

John Michael Kohler Arts Center

1.3 mi

The John Michael Kohler Arts Center is a renowned institution dedicated to contemporary arts, featuring diverse exhibitions that often push creative boundaries. Beyond its galleries, the center is celebrated for its immersive artist-built environments and its strong community engagement programs. It offers a tranquil yet stimulating escape, perfect for appreciating art and culture. The center also hosts performances and educational workshops, making it a dynamic cultural hub in downtown Sheboygan.

Sheboygan Indian Bowl Museum

2.1 mi

The Sheboygan Indian Bowl Museum offers a unique glimpse into the history of this historic athletic stadium and its significance to the community. Originally built in the 1920s, the stadium has hosted numerous sporting events and concerts. The museum details its past, including its role in local sports and its architectural importance. It’s a fascinating stop for history buffs and sports enthusiasts looking to understand the legacy of this iconic Sheboygan landmark.

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Sheboygan brings cold temperatures, often with highs in the 20s and 30s Fahrenheit, and the potential for significant snowfall. Visitors should dress in heavy, insulated layers, including hats, gloves, and waterproof outer gear. Lake Michigan can be dramatic and icy, making walks along the shoreline brisk but beautiful. Park access may be affected by snow accumulation, and certain park facilities like the carousel will be closed.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ring sees temperatures gradually warming from chilly to mild, with average highs ranging from the 40s to the 60s Fahrenheit. Light jackets or hoodies are generally sufficient, though rain is common, so waterproof outerwear and footwear are advisable. Early summer continues this trend, with temperatures becoming warmer and more humid, typically reaching the 70s Fahrenheit. Pack light layers and be prepared for occasional rain showers.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er, from July to August, is the warmest period, with average highs in the upper 70s to low 80s Fahrenheit. Humidity can be noticeable, making it feel warmer. Light, breathable clothing is recommended. S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ses are essential for extended outdoor time. Evenings can offer a pleasant breeze off the lake, but bringing a light layer is wise for cooler transitions.

🍂

Fall season

Fall brings crisp air and cooling temperatures, with highs steadily dropping from the 70s in September down into the 50s and 40s Fahrenheit by November. Layers become crucial, including sweaters, jackets, and perhaps a warmer coat as the season progresses. The park offers beautiful autumn foliage views. The possibility of early snow increases later in the fall.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is possible throughout the year, with spring and fall often seeing more frequent precipitation. Summer can experience thunderstorms. Snowfall is characteristic of winter months, potentially impacting park access and outdoor activities. Always check local weather forecasts before visiting, and pack accordingly for damp or snowy conditions, including waterproof gear and sturdy, slip-resistant footwear.
